Output cfbf8a140a15c23c3d978814b4f9a2db8b47832a18b39bce5e234855a8abbc60:17

value
26933255
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e75439a019d70ff3c74e33257960826238172f414c3b8a580ad3661fb5885aa
address
tb1pde658xspn4c070r5uve909sgyc3czuh5znpm3fvq45mxr76csk4q2wrlr4
transaction
cfbf8a140a15c23c3d978814b4f9a2db8b47832a18b39bce5e234855a8abbc60
confirmations
10473
spent
true